Job Purpose:    

Responsible for conducting energy audits for mid to large commercial customers. Provide oversight and manage OUC energy and water efficiency commercial non-prescriptive rebates/incentives. Monitor performance of sustainability programs and ensure OUC and program goals are met.

Primary Functions:        

  • Analyze business processes of OUC’s commercial customers through on-site inspections with utility consumption analysis tools;
  • Recommend implementation of measures and operational changes; perform cost benefit calculations for OUC’s commercial customers;
  • Collaborate with OUC Corporate Sustainability & Facilities on OUC portfolio of buildings.
  • Aggregate and report on measurement and verification data to validate progress towards goal attainment;
  • Provide guidance for database management, monitoring, analysis, and reporting;
  • Perform pre/ post inspections to ensure program standards are met;
  • Interact with customers to discuss the efficiency opportunities and program requirements;
  • Actively engage OUC commercial customers for energy and water audits and program participation;
  • Process incentive applications for customers; provide approvals within correct range;
  • Provide input into the development of reasonable energy and water reduction goals;
  • Mentor and guide junior team members;
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
